Aaron Banks
Aaron Banks (Democratic Party) is a member of the Jackson City Council in Mississippi, representing Ward 6. Banks assumed office in 2017. Banks' current term ends on July 1, 2025.
Banks (Democratic Party) ran for re-election to the Jackson City Council to represent Ward 6 in Mississippi. Banks won in the general election on June 8, 2021.

General election
General election for Jackson City Council Ward 6
Incumbent Aaron Banks defeated Zidkejah Wilks in the general election for Jackson City Council Ward 6 on June 8, 2021.
Candidate | % | Votes | ||
✔ | Aaron Banks (D) | 88.4 | 1,983 | |
Zidkejah Wilks (R) | 11.6 | 260 |
Total votes: 2,243 | ||||

Democratic primary election
Democratic primary for Jackson City Council Ward 6
Incumbent Aaron Banks defeated Patricia Jackson and Brad Davis in the Democratic primary for Jackson City Council Ward 6 on April 6, 2021.
Candidate | % | Votes | ||
✔ | Aaron Banks | 69.5 | 1,704 | |
Patricia Jackson | 23.1 | 566 | ||
Brad Davis | 7.4 | 182 |
Total votes: 2,452 | ||||
